How to remove traces of grass from clothes?

It should be noted right away that the fresher the stain, the easier and faster it can be removed. We will tell you how to get rid of such pollution as the complexity and volume of work increase.

Method 1

To get started, try removing traces of grass with boiling water and laundry soap. Usually with very recent spots, the use of this method is enough. You need to do this:

  1. Pour boiled water over the stained fabric area.
  2. Rub with soap and wash immediately.
  3. Repeat the process if necessary.
  4. Wash along with other things in the washing machine.

Method 2

You can try to soak a thing in detergent, but usually with old herbal dirt, this number does not work. If the stain is fresh, proceed as follows:

  1. Soak the item in hot water with sufficient powder.
  2. Leave it in water for 2-3 hours.
  3. Thoroughly wash the stained area with your hands.
  4. Wash and rinse in the typewriter.

How else can grass be removed from clothes?

If the stain is old and so simple it does not lend itself to you, we have some simple and effective tips to nevertheless return a presentable look to clothes.

Tip 1

Act on spots directly. To do this, you will need ammonia, household soap and water. Use these products this way:

  1. In a glass of warm water, add 1 tsp. ammonia.
  2. Soak a cotton swab in the solution and wipe the dirt.
  3. Rub with soap on top.
  4. Leave the product to process traces of grass for 2 hours.
  5. After this time, wash first with your hands, then the whole thing.

Tip 2

Vinegar is a natural oxidizing agent. He is also able to help remove grass from the inside of the fabric. Use it like this:

  1. Dilute 1 tablespoon in 100 ml of water. vinegar.
  2. Apply only to dirt.
  3. Leave the vinegar to oxidize the stain for 30 minutes.
  4. Hand rub the stained area and wash the whole thing.

Note: oxalic acid can enhance the effect of table vinegar. Add 1 tablespoon to the solution. substances and treat the stain in the same way.

Tip 3

How to wash grassIn the people, the simplest salt is considered the best way to combat old spots. To use it qualitatively for washing grass from clothes, follow these instructions:

  1. Prepare a saline solution: 1 tbsp. warm water 1 tbsp salt.
  2. Pour into a convenient vessel for soaking.
  3. Only place contaminated spots in the solution.
  4. Leave on for 20 minutes.
  5. Wash your way.

Tip 4

Another excellent tool in the fight against herbal footprints on the fabric is denatured alcohol. It is a good solvent, so this type of pollution is easily amenable to it. Use alcohol like this:

  1. Moisten a clean sponge with alcohol.
  2. Wipe all green marks with the product until they dissolve.
  3. Wash with powder or soap.

Tip 5

As for white clothes, hydrogen peroxide will perfectly cope with stains from grass on it. Using this tool is simple:

  1. Prepare the solution: 20 ml of hydrogen peroxide per 80 ml of water.
  2. Soak traces of grass from the solution.
  3. Wipe with your hands.
  4. Wash in powder or laundry soap.

Method 6

Glycerin is famous for its cleansing properties, therefore, when removing this kind of impurities, it is also used:

  1. Take the protein of one egg.
  2. Add 2 tsp. glycerin.
  3. Apply the mixture to the stains.
  4. After an hour, wash and rinse.

Method 7

Citric acid or lemon juice is also great for quickly removing grass from clothing. For this:

  1. Fill the stain with juice or fill it with one bag of acid. If using powder, lightly wet the cloth or spray on top of the applied product.
  2. Wait 30 minutes.
  3. Rub the stain with your hands and wash in the usual way.

How to effectively remove grass from clothes?

A couple more solutions to the “herbal” problem on clothes.

Solution 1

No one canceled the use of washing store products. In this case, the stain remover can even come in handy. Do as follows:

  1. Apply it on a stain and leave for 15-20 minutes.
  2. Soak according to manufacturer's instructions.
  3. After 1-2 hours, wash first with your hands, then in the washing machine.

Decision 2

Laundry soap with ammonia is an excellent remedy for grass on clothes. Combine them like this:

  1. Grate the soap on a grater.
  2. Put in hot water.
  3. Pour in 1 tsp. ammonia.
  4. Soak only the area of ​​contamination.
  5. Wash after 7-10 minutes.
